How do you evaluate a new DeFi token launched via an IDO before it reaches the liquidity pool?

Start by examining the project's tokenomics including total supply, allocation percentages for team vesting schedules, liquidity allocation, and any token burn mechanisms. A healthy IDO typically allocates no more than 10-15 percent to the team with a vesting schedule of at least 12-24 months to prevent immediate dumps. Next review the smart contract audits from reputable firms and check for any known vulnerabilities that could lead to rug pulls or flash loan attacks. Use fundamental analysis tools like assessing the project's actual utility, competitive landscape, and realistic adoption path rather than hype. Monitor on-chain data for whale accumulation or sudden large transfers that signal potential exit liquidity traps. Community traders often approach new DeFi token evaluations by cross-referencing tokenomics details against historical rug pull patterns and emphasizing the need for audited smart contracts before committing capital. A common perspective highlights the importance of checking vesting schedules and liquidity lock proofs to avoid immediate sell pressure once the token hits the liquidity pool. Many express caution around projects with high team allocations or unclear utility, drawing parallels to how macro events can amplify downside in thinly traded assets. There is frequent discussion about starting with minimal position sizing and scaling only after observing real market behavior, mirroring risk-managed approaches seen in options trading. Misconceptions include assuming strong pre-launch hype guarantees success or overlooking on-chain red flags like concentrated whale wallets. Overall the consensus stresses patience, verification across multiple data layers, and treating new IDO tokens with the same skepticism applied to high-volatility market environments.
